package org.jgraph.pad.actions;

import org.jgraph.GPGraphpad;

import javax.swing.*;
import java.awt.event.ActionEvent;
import java.beans.PropertyVetoException;

/**
 * Cascades all JInternalFrames at the
 * Desktop.
 *
 * @author sven.luzar
 * @version 1.0
 *
 */
public class WindowCascade extends AbstractActionDefault {

	/**
	 * Constructor for WindowCascade.
	 * @param graphpad
	 */
	public WindowCascade(GPGraphpad graphpad) {
		super(graphpad);
	}

	/**
	 * Calls the method setLocation, setSize
	 * and toFont for each JInternalFrame.
	 *
	 * @see java.awt.event.ActionListener#actionPerformed(ActionEvent)
	 */
	public void actionPerformed(ActionEvent e) {
		JInternalFrame[] ajif = graphpad.getAllFrames();
		if (!(ajif.length > 0))
			return;

		try {
			ajif[0].setMaximum(true);
		} catch (PropertyVetoException pve) {
		}

		int desktopX = ajif[0].getX();
		int desktopY = ajif[0].getY();
		int desktopWidth = ajif[0].getWidth();
		int desktopHeight = ajif[0].getHeight();
		int diffWidth = 20;
		int diffHeight = 20;

		for (int i = 0; i < ajif.length; i++) {
			int frmWidth = desktopWidth - (ajif.length - 1) * diffWidth;
			int frmHeight = desktopHeight - (ajif.length - 1) * diffHeight;

			try {
				ajif[i].setIcon(false);
				ajif[i].setMaximum(false);
			} catch (PropertyVetoException pvex) {
				// do nothing only display error
			}

			ajif[i].setLocation(desktopX, desktopY);
			ajif[i].setSize(frmWidth, frmHeight);
			ajif[i].toFront();

			try {
				ajif[i].setSelected(true);
			} catch (PropertyVetoException pvex) {
				// do nothing only display error
			}

			desktopX += diffWidth;
			desktopY += diffHeight;
		}
	}

}
